Is this an ongoing list of concerts at the Pomp room? Because there was WAYYY more than 9 concerts there. I started attending shows there in 1994 and from that point on I was addicted to that place. Now REMEMBERING them all or the dates is another story. Too much partying back then has washed away most details unfortunately but believe me this place was consistently popping and on any given day you could stumble upon a sea of red, green, blue, etc heads of hair, Mohawks, liberty spikes. That place was is and always will be the soundtrack to my youth. I found love there. I lost love there. I laughed, cried, and screamed there. They tore it down. The only place we had to go to catch some culture in this hick midwest wasteland town that didn't involve drugs or.booze. they tore down my soundtrack. They probably tore down some kids reason to live without a second thought. For so.e of us that place was the only warmth, the only hug, the only smile in our miserable young street punk lives, and it was bulldozed to make a parking garage that hasn't been used in 24yrs by more than a handful of ppl a day.
